Five Pacific teams to take part in the 12th Asia Pacific Bowls in New Zealand

11:11 am on 9 January 2007

Five Pacific teams have been listed as taking part in the 12 Asia Pacific bowls championships in New Zealand starting this weekend.

Fiji, Cook Islands, Norfolk Island, Papua New Guinea, and Samoa will join 12 other teams from other round the world for the week long event.

This year's Championship will have an added edge as the event is a qualifying tournament for the 2008 World Bowls Championships also to be held in Christchurch.

Eight men's and seven women's teams will qualify to join already qualified Australia, NZ and Canada in the men's with Malaysia in the women's section instead of Canada.
